+print_help() {
+ echo ""
+ print_usage
+ echo ""
+ echo "This plugin checks the space available in the pool against the space required for the next scheduled backups"
+ echo "Example : $PROGNAME -P default -M LTO -w 20 -c 10 will check the default pool, return OK if (available space) > 1,20*(required space), WARNING if 1,20*(required space) > (available space) > 1,10*(required space), and CRITICAL else."
+ echo ""
+ echo "With the -S option, it will check the pool named Scratch and return WARNING instead of CRITICAL if the Scratch pool can save the situation."
+ echo "Example : $PROGNAME -P default -M LTO -w 20 -c 10 -S will check the default pool, return OK if (available space) > 1,20*(required space), WARNING if 1,20*(required space) > (available space) > 1,10*(required space) or if (available space in default and Scratch) > 1,10*(required space) > (available space in default), and CRITICAL else."
+ echo ""
+ echo "The evaluation of the space required is done by adding the biggest backups of the same level than the scheduled jobs"
+ echo "The available space is evaluated by the number of out of retention tapes and the average VolBytes of these Full tapes"
+ echo ""
+ echo "The Information Status are : \"Required, Available, Volume Errors\" and \"Will use Scratch pool\" if necessary."
+ echo ""
+ echo "I think this plugin should be used in passive mode, and ran by a RunAfterJob"
+ exit 3
+}

General:
+08Jul06
+ ======================= Warning ==========================
+ Implemented new method of getting the default Storage from the Media
+ record rather than from the MediaType for restore. As a fall
+ back, if no Storage is defined, use the MediaType. This
+ eliminates most all prompts if there are multiple MediaTypes
+ used. This is an important and fundamental change.
+ ==========================================================
+
+- Add more detail (Storage, Device) to list of volumes printed
+ for restore.
+- More code in migrate. In particular start multiple jobs if
+ migrating a volume.
+- Probably overkill, but ensure that the bsr is unique even within a
+ job in FD and SD.
+- Rework bsys.c drop() so that it now should work as expected.
+- Update a bunch of old copyrights -- particularly in .h files.
+- Remove src/lib/bshm.c/h
